diff --git a/docker/rootfs/startapp.sh b/docker/rootfs/startapp.sh
index 8cafdeb26f2e4a2973eb2fbb6180009e75c3f3c1..d625ec2438d311a8af10a69f68d92f75f284a1cb 100644
--- a/docker/rootfs/startapp.sh
+++ b/docker/rootfs/startapp.sh
@@ -22,7 +22,7 @@ for jar in `ls lib/*.jar`; do
     CLASSPATH=${CLASSPATH}:${jar}
 done
 
-if [ -f /.dockerenv ]; then
+if [ -f /.dockerenv ] || [ -f /run/.containerenv ]; then
     echo "[startapp] Running in container"
     if [ -z "$IP_ADDR" ]; then
         export IP_ADDR=$(hostname -i)